So we aren’t scoring many goals, our top scorer is OG, and we all keep discussing strike pairings as if it’s suddenly going to click us into scoring 4 a game. You’re wrong, it won’t. Be it Billy with Oli, Didsy with Moose or Billy with Robinson - we simply will not become a free scoring team and that’s because of the shape and the organisation of the team. This is not a thread to slander ANY of the attackers so please don’t turn it into a slanging match because I can’t be arsed to see it. It’s not like they’re having chances put on a platter week in week out
We have abandoned our old shape of one behind the attacker but in honesty we did a lot towards the end of last season. Duffy often dropping in. After the collapse at Villa the mindset changed and we haven’t lost away from home since so you can’t say it’s not worked. Our priority now is to keep the ball out of the net first and foremost.
For the team to be free scoring with the system we currently play the front 2 would need to be Messi and Mbappe. There is no link between the midfield and attack that is quick enough to spring any sort of counter and when the defences are packed we don’t quite have the quality to unlock them. And that’s ok - we’re newly promoted and we’ve been fucking good.
The balance we currently have has us as the joint second best team is the division defensively. Better than or equal to Man City, Spurs, Arsenal and Man United. We aren’t going to our score these teams (see Norwich’s approach for proof of that) but we can be solid first and foremost, then you only need 1 to win. Make sure we don’t concede first, try and score second. It might not be what you want to see, but it is what will keep us in the division.
